SUMMARY

I'd like to use Kate, but it lacks support for the character composition
keystrokes to which I became accustomed after switching from Mac OS X to
FreeBSD-based systems. 

I assume that Kate for Linux also lacks support. 

STEPS TO REPRODUCE

1. Perform these six keystrokes: 

Control-Shift-U
2
0
2
6
Space bar 

OBSERVED RESULT

2026 

~~~~^
– there's a space


EXPECTED RESULT

…

– a single character.
